Let's get straight to the point: Most SMS receive platforms can only help you "receive" text messages—they cannot send notifications on your behalf. This distinction still trips up plenty of cross-border sellers entering the game in 2026, and it's costing them dearly in account registration, account warming, and bulk operations.
Why? Because the core purpose of an SMS receive service is to provide a temporary or virtual phone number that can receive verification codes from platforms. It solves the "I don't have a second phone number" problem—not the "I need to send bulk notifications to users" problem. These are two completely different business models.
People running independent sites, TikTok Shops, or multiple Amazon accounts frequently lump "SMS receiving" and "SMS gateway" into one bucket. I'll say it plainly: this is one of the most common misconceptions in the cross-border space in 2026.
The core capability of an SMS receive platform is inbound only. You register a foreign account, the platform asks for phone verification, you enter the number provided by the receive service, then check the dashboard for the verification code. Throughout that entire process, you're purely a "receiver."
But "sending SMS notifications" means something entirely different. It means you have a business system that needs to proactively send texts to your users, customers, or team members—think order alerts, shipping updates, or marketing pushes. That requires a SMS API gateway, not an SMS receive service.
I've seen cross-border studios try to cut corners by using receive-service numbers to blast marketing texts. The result? Carriers flag the numbers, target platforms mark them as spam, and delivery rates crater to under 20%—or worse, the entire business account gets linked and banned. This isn't fear-mongering. In 2026, platforms score sender reputation ruthlessly.

In 2026, if you genuinely need to send SMS notifications to overseas users, the legitimate route is integrating with international SMS API providers like Twilio or MessageBird, or working with domestic providers that hold cross-border SMS licenses. Their numbers support two-way communication, but they cost significantly more—a single US text typically runs $0.05 to $0.10. A receive-platform verification code might cost you a fraction of a cent. You get what you pay for, and that rule applies just as much in the SMS industry.

Here's how it works: you complete registration verification through a receive platform, then immediately rebind the account to a virtual number you actually control—like Google Voice, a toll-free number, or a VoIP service that supports number porting. From that point forward, any SMS notifications the platform sends get forwarded to your bound number, and you can keep receiving them reliably.
The key is the window for "number porting" or "binding changes." Some platforms allow you to swap your bound phone number within 24 hours of registration; others require a 7-day minimum. You need to plan ahead—don't wait until your account is already in trouble to think about rebinding.
